LASUSTECH students share mixed opinions on Bobrisky's Best Dressed Female Award


By Oluwanifemi Adeyemi And Faith Mcakinsajijo  


"I love my sisterhood no cap! But e get some haters among them. Una dey claim real women blah blah but I won hands down! Who come be the real woman now? Don't play! "

The above statement was made by controversial Nigerian crossdresser Idris Okuneye, popularly known as Bobrisky, after he was awarded the best dressed female at the premier of the movie 'Ajakaju: The beast of two worlds'. 

While some people expressed their displeasure about this turn of events, others however, are in support of the decision made. Here is what people have to say about the issue.

Mohammed Balikis, a student of Mass Communication department, Lagos State University of Science and Technology (LASUSTECH), said, "They should not have given him the award because there are other women out there who deserved it. He did not deserve it, after all, he is a male not a female."

Akande Oluwatobiloba, a resident of Lambo Lasunwo community also said that, " Giving him the best dressed female award is an abuse and embarrassment to the women in our society. It is not encouraging for the generation to come".

Adebisi Ayomikun, a student of Mass Communication department, however said that, " Nobody complained when he was dressing as a female and they were also selling the clothes to him. Now that he collected the award I don't think there should be any problem. Nobody can blame him". 

Omobolanle Adenike, also a student of LASUSTECH said, " Everybody saw the way he was doing before and how he was acting like a girl from day one, but no one said anything about that. Now, because of the 1 million naira he won everyone is going against him, it's not fair. They should better leave his money for him and not spoil his win because he's the best". 


Recalled that the moment Bobrisky was given the award, the notorious musician/entertainer, Habeeb Okikiola, popularly referred to as portable said, " Na so I hear say dem give Bobrisky best female dressed of the year for movie. Shey na woman? No be artificial? Bobrisky na man".

He also went ahead to ridicule Bobrisky in his diss track saying, " Warn brotherhood, if he comes to my hood, if he comes dressed as sisterhood, he'll be dealt with, with firewood".

Tragic Accident Claims Lives of Two LASUSTECH Students in Ikorodu

By Habeeb Ibrahim, Odeyemi Ibukun and Bisiriyu Hassan The Lagos State University of Science and Technology (LASUSTECH), Ikorodu, community is mourning the loss of two of its students following a fatal accident on Saturday  morning at Powerline Junction, before Aleje, inward Ikorodu Roundabout, Lagos. The deceased students have been identified as: Ayomide Jagun , 300 Level, Mechatronics Afọlábí Emmanuel , 200 Level, Banking and Finance (Direct Entry) According to eyewitnesses, the accident involved a sand-laden tipper truck, a Toyota Corolla, a multi-purpose bus, and several tricycles. Preliminary reports indicate that the tipper, reportedly speeding, suffered a brake failure, causing it to collide with other vehicles along the busy road. While initial reports suggested multiple casualties, only the deaths of the two LASUSTECH students and a one SS 3 student of Ikorodu High School have been officially confirmed. Students Barred from LASUSTECH First Gate Over Safety Concerns

By Habeeb Ibrahim and Adefeso Precious Students of the Lagos State University of Science and Technology (LASUSTECH) were on Monday morning restricted from accessing the campus through the First Gate, tagged as West Gate 1, due to safety concerns. The restriction led to confusion among students, who were subsequently directed by security personnel to use the Second Gate for entry into the campus. Speaking on the development, security officials disclosed that the action followed an incident that occurred around 7:00 p.m. on Sunday, when a tension wire was reportedly cut from a pole and fell directly at the entrance of First Gate. According to the security personnel, the fallen wire posed a potential risk of injury, electric shock, or sparks to students and other individuals passing through the gate. LASUSTECH Announces February 13, 2027, for Maiden Convocation

By Adetoyinbo Berachah The Lagos State University of Science and Technology (LASUSTECH) has announced February 13, 2027, as the date for its maiden convocation. The announcement was made by the Director of Student Affairs (DSA), Dr. Ademola Aderogba, during the first engagement meeting of the 2025/2026 academic session. The meeting featured the introduction of Heads of Class (HOCs) and representatives from various departments. Dr. Aderogba addressed issues relating to the academic session and outlined expectations for students. He presented an overview of academic results across colleges and departments, noting variations in performance. Students were advised to ensure lecturers are invited for scheduled lectures. According to the DSA, all issues relating to academic results must be resolved before January 27, 2026, when the University Senate will review them.
